Database Optimization: Strategies for Peak Performance

Achieving optimal database performance is essential for any application that relies on data. To ensure peak efficiency, a multi-faceted approach to database optimization is necessary.

  • One effective strategy is to adjust your queries. By identifying areas where performance issues exist, you can restructure them for better execution latency.
  • Another important element is to implement proper indexing. Indexes speed up data retrieval by establishing pointers to relevant data locations.
  • Moreover, consistent database maintenance is vital for maintaining optimal performance. This covers tasks such as reorganization to improve data access and overall system stability.
